Top 10 Safest Cities in India 2025 | Discover Which City Leads the Safety Index

As India’s urban population continues to grow, safety has become a top priority for residents and travellers alike. According to the Numbeo Safety Index mid-2025, India ranks 67th globally with a moderate safety score of 55.8. While some cities face challenges, others stand out for low crime rates, effective law enforcement , and strong civic systems. Here’s a look at the top 10 safest cities in India 2025 and what makes them a secure choice for living and visiting.

1. Mangalore, Karnataka – Safety Index: 74.3


Mangalore tops the list as the safest city in India in 2025. Known for its serene beaches, courteous residents, and robust police presence, this coastal city offers a tranquil lifestyle. Low crime rates, strong community trust, and a growing IT sector make Mangalore ideal for families and professionals.

2. Vadodara, Gujarat – Safety Index: 69.3


Vadodara, also known as Baroda, ranks second. Combining cultural heritage with modern development, the city boasts low crime, efficient traffic management, and proactive policing. Vadodara is considered one of western India’s safest cities, particularly for women.


3. Ahmedabad, Gujarat – Safety Index: 68.5


Ahmedabad remains a safe metropolitan hub, balancing business growth with security. With a widespread CCTV network, active community policing, and strong public safety measures, the city is a reliable destination for residents and tourists alike.

4. Surat, Gujarat – Safety Index: 66.6


Known as India’s “Diamond City,” Surat offers cleanliness, order, and security. Its excellent safety record stems from civic efficiency, law-abiding citizens, and tech-driven policing. Women feel especially secure in Surat, making it a standout among urban areas.


5. Jaipur, Rajasthan – Safety Index: 65.3


The “Pink City” of Jaipur mixes modern safety strategies with its royal charm. A visible police presence and community engagement keep crime low, making Jaipur one of North India’s safest cities for tourists and locals alike.

6. Navi Mumbai, Maharashtra – Safety Index: 63.5


Navi Mumbai is celebrated for well-planned infrastructure, cleanliness, and efficient law enforcement. Less congested than its neighbouring metropolis, it benefits from digital surveillance and rapid emergency services, ensuring a secure living environment.

7.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ala – Safety Index: 61.0


Kerala’s capital offers calm surroundings and a responsible populace. With high public safety awareness, women’s protection programs, and modernised policing, Thiruvananthapuram remains one of India’s most peaceful urban centres.

8. Chennai, Tamil Nadu – Safety Index: 60.0


Chennai combines a skilled police force with civic-minded residents to create a safe urban environment. Its traffic management, public safety initiatives, and family-friendly culture make it a desirable city for professionals and households.


9. Pune, Maharashtra – Safety Index: 58.7


Pune, known as the “Oxford of the East,” maintains a student-friendly, secure atmosphere. Advanced security systems, digital complaint platforms, and routine police patrols help keep crime rates low, ensuring a safe environment for students and working professionals.

10. Chandigarh – Safety Index: 57.6


Chandigarh, the capital of Punjab and Haryana, is renowned for its cleanliness, greenery, and well-planned layout. Proactive community policing and prompt law enforcement make Chandigarh a city where both residents and tourists feel truly secure.
